About

Broad Canyon Campground and Trailhead sits at 7,800 feet elevation in the Copper Basin area of the Lost River Ranger District. The eight primitive campsites are nestled in a wooded setting, providing a peaceful base for exploring the surrounding backcountry. Equestrians will find hitching rails on site, and the location serves as a jumping-off point for Broad Canyon Trail, Jarvis Trail, and Bellas Trail. The campground is quite remote, reached via a series of forest roads from Mackay. Facilities are minimal: one accessible vault toilet is provided, but no drinking water is available. Campers should come fully self-sufficient with water, food, and supplies. All Salmon-Challis National Forest campgrounds operate on a first-come, first-served basis with no advance reservations.

Directions

From Mackay, take US Highway 93 north approximately 16 miles to Trail Creek Road (FS Road 208). Turn left and follow Trail Creek Road approximately 18 miles, then turn left onto Copper Basin Road (FS Road 135). Follow Copper Basin Road 13 miles and turn right onto Copper Basin Loop Road (FS Road 138). Continue 7.5 miles to Broad Canyon Road, turn right, and proceed 0.5 miles to the trailhead and campground.
